THE HON'BLE SRI JUSTICE T.AMARNATH GOUD WRIT PETITION NO.17634 OF 2007 ORDER:

This writ petition is filed seeking to declare the action of the respondent in not paying compensation amount to the petitioner as illegal, arbitrary and violative of Article 21 of the Constitution of India and consequently direct the respondent to pay compensation amount to the petitioner.

2.

It is the case of the petitioner that compensation has not been paid by the respondent to the petitioner for the lands acquired for public purpose.

3.

Heard.

4.

The Government Pleader for Land Acquisition for the State of Telangana filed a letter No.E/781/81, dated 29-3-2008 addressed by the respondent to the Senior Civil Judge, Karimnagar, wherein a cheque bearing No.845739 dated 28-03-2008 for an amount of Rs.3,60,189/- (Rupees three lands, sixty thousand, one hundred and eighty nine only) has been deposited towards decretal amount in O.P.No.869 of 1982 on the file of the Senior Civil Judge, Karimnagar, wherein the petitioner is claimant in the said O.P.

5.

Recording the above submission, the writ petition is disposed of. No order as to costs. As a sequel, the miscellaneous petitions pending if any shall stand closed.
